Abstract

This paper presents an ongoing work which aims to make a step forward in advanced domotic systems and specific intelligent interfaces for shared virtual spaces that represent real world situations. The main contribution is to explain the exploitation and integration of tools and ideas to accomplish this objective, focusing mostly on high level languages – for an integral space design, open source projects like VRML/X3D, JAVA3D or OPENGL – implementation tools, Virtual Reality and Domotics (as domains for application)
